On the afternoon of April 23, the Department of Culture and Sports coordinated with relevant units to organize the "Vong" Fine Arts Exhibition at the Da Nang Museum. The event aims to celebrate the 50th anniversary of the liberation of the South and the reunification of the country (April 30, 1975 - April 30, 2025).
Here, more than 70 works of artists, painters, and architects are displayed in combination with a virtual reality technology experience space. The exhibition introduces visitors to artistic activities that apply technological elements in expressing forms and messages.
The exhibition is divided into three main topics. Part one "Vong the hut" is inspired by the art of Bai Choi, helping the audience to feel the sound of culture, the memories of the community. At the same time, visitors can also admire the new beauty from the familiar folk game right on the banks of the Han River.
The second part "AR Scene Voice" is a combination of technology and art, helping to recreate the picture of traditional craft villages, tangible and intangible cultural heritages of Da Nang city, in addition to depicting the harmony between nature and Da Nang people.
The third part "Da Nang Monuments through the perspective of paintings" - this is a place to display more than 50 paintings with many colors, diverse perspectives, recreating the city's typical relics and architectural works through many emotions and impressions of time.
